Tourists play with rabbit-shaped lanterns at Hongcun Village in Yixian County, east China's Anhui Province, Jan. 30, 2023.

Tourists here learned making rabbit-shaped lanterns and take part in a lantern parade to celebrate the Chinese New Year. [Xinhua/Du Yu]
